    Return of the Jedi is a haunted movie. It is haunted most obviously by the ghosts of the past films: droids walking across desert wastes, fateful holograms delivered in desperation, deflector shield substations, robotic hands, and a Death Star hanging above the world. But it is also haunted by the future of the franchise: further reliance on ambitious CGI, a subtle sanding down in humor and character, dozens of little creatures whose names are never said but whose identity marketing has taught you before you ever see the text start rolling across the screen.

    Star Wars, as we know it, has arrived.
